Coordinating AgenciesRegistering with NIMAC

Who coordinates?• A State Department of Education representative,

such as: State Director of Education, or

NIMAS NIMAC State Coordinator, or State Counsel, or State Director of Special Education, etc.

What must they do?• Sign Coordination Agreement• Mail Copy to NIMAC

Next Steps . . .

• The SEA representative identifies Authorized Users for your state.

• These authorized users will be identified from among state, local, regional, or educational agencies.

How are Authorized Users designated?

1. Complete web form at NIMAC site

2. The Authorized User signs the Limitation of Use (LUA) Agreement before gaining access to files.

3. The Authorized User mails LUA to NIMAC.

What Happens Next?

• Once NIMAC has received the signed LUA for the Authorized User, NIMAC will send user id and password!

• Authorized User may download files!

• Authorized User may assign files to Accessible Media Producers (AMPs)!
